Instructions
  1. Gather all your ingredients to start.
  2. Peel, core, and dice the apple. Add the apple to a small mixing bowl and toss with lemon juice.
  3. Add all ingredients to a large mixing bowl.
  4. Stir gently to combine.
  5. Cover and chill for at least 2 hours before serving.
Recipe Notes

This carrot raisin salad can be stored in an airtight container and kept refrigerated for 2-3 days.
